## Further reading

The Parcelwing webhook fans out delivery-scan events to downstream consumers. If you're on call, know three things: retries are exponential with a six-hour cap, signatures rotate weekly, and dead-lettered events land in the `pw-dlq` queue. Replay tooling is in the `pw-replay` repo. For escalation paths, payload schemas, and the full retry matrix, see the internal wiki page linked below.

operations page: https://jira.qorvelsys.internal/browse/pages/browse/pages

Handover note — Crumbwheel order cutoffs.

Welcome aboard. The bakery cutoff rule in Crumbwheel closes same-day orders at 14:00 local to each storefront, not UTC — this has bitten us twice. Holiday overrides live in the calendar service and take precedence silently, so always check there first when a cutoff looks wrong. To unlock the calendar service's admin console after a restart, enter the recovery passphrase below.

vault phrase of bagap-bahaf = silion-pelox-sorox-casdor-quenwyn-fraax-eliox-praael-kelion-quenvan-kasox-rusael-norius-belvan

Handover — Graphlet visualizer, from Dario to Ines.

Edge-bundling branch merged; layout cache rebuilt nightly. Release 2.4 blocked only on the signed manifest step. Cycle-detection flag is off in staging, on in prod — don't flip it. The Ternwick render farm account was rotated Tuesday; old tokens are dead. To unseal the manifest signer during the release, use the recovery passphrase noted directly below.

vault phrase of tajop-haduf = holath-brivan-wenax